Council approves annexation of Dove Creek residential parcels into community facilities district; ordinance introduced
Summary
The council adopted a resolution to annex the residential portion of the Dove Creek mixed-use project into the city's Community Facilities District (CFD), certified a landowner vote (one landowner, six votes) in favor, and introduced an ordinance to authorize the special tax for first reading; a second reading will follow to finalize the levy.
The Atascadero City Council on Tuesday approved annexation of the residential portion of the Dove Creek mixed-use development into the city's Community Facilities District (CFD), certified a landowner election in favor and introduced an ordinance to authorize a special tax for the district's residential units.
